Job Summary
Conduct property tours, process lease documentation including credit screening and move-in packages, and inspect units prior to occupancy. Develop marketing plans to sustain occupancy, create promotional materials to generate revenue, and direct sales activities to meet property goals. Build relationships with prospective residents, assist with lease renewals, and ensure satisfaction throughout the lease term. Work indoors approximately 95% of the time, perform physical inspections requiring stair access, and maintain availability for emergencies or natural disasters.
